I've made a tally of areas the applications come in. Note: the numbers don't necessarily match up one to one; some applications mentioned more than one area of interest, others didn't clearly indicate one or the other besides cursory mentions, and let's face it, I might have miscounted. Also note: this list does not indicate in any way, shape, or form acceptance or rejection to the program; we have only just started to rate and we can't talk about that process until the appropriate date.
* 31 clients: 20 desktop (mostly multiplatform) and 11 mobile (4 Android and 3 iPhone, among others) * 13 Named commenting level * 6 external site integration projects, including OAuth, Facebook, WordPress, Blogger * 4 production server monitoring * 4 polls * 3 Usability and/or WAI-ARIA * 2 usage and/or business statistics * 2 RTE overhaul * 1 Calendar * 1 HTML to Journal Theme * 1 XMPP IM Service * 1 Media hosting
